Renew your TTC Metropass online until Nov. 20

York University faculty, staff and students can renew their December TTC Metropasses online from today until Nov. 20.

At $87 the cost is a discounted rate of 12 per cent. To be eligible to renew your TTC Metropass online, you must meet the following requirements:

  • You must be a current student, staff or faculty member of York University.
  • You must have purchased a TTC Metropass in person through the Parking & Transportation Office and provided the appropriate identification within the 2005-2006 academic year.
  • Payment must be online using a Visa, MasterCard or American Express credit card.

Faculty, staff and students who use the online service can pick up their December TTC Metropasses from Parking & Transportation Services, located in Room 222, The William Small Centre on York’s Keele campus, beginning Nov. 24. Passes can be picked up during regular business hours or they can be mailed to a home or local address.

Metropasses that are lost (including those lost by Canada Post) or stolen cannot be replaced by the Parking & Transportation office. Replacements must be obtained through regular TTC outlets for the standard TTC price.

Applications for renewals of the December TTC Metropass through the new online service will be accepted on the following dates only:

  • Nov. 10-20, with pick-up from Parking & Transportation Services from Nov. 24.

Daily blood donor clinics begin Monday
Canadian Blood Services will hold a blood donor clinic daily in the East Bear Pit, Central Square, next week. Donors can visit from noon to 4pm, Monday to Thursday, and from 9:30am to 1:30pm on Friday. Also on Friday, students, faculty and staff can register with the Bone Marrow Registry.

GO bus stops to be relocated during landscape work
Landscape work on the north side of Accolade West, Burton Auditorium and Centre for Film & Theatre will begin Monday, weather permitting. The work will require a temporary relocation of GO Transit stops which will be coordinated through GO Transit. Facilities Services staff and the contractor will do their best to minimize disruption to customers and apologize for any inconvenience.
